Measurement And Analysis Of Plants Of Reflectance Spectrum On The Visible And Near Infrared

Visible and near-infrared reflectance spectra of plant are basic data for applications in remote sensing classification,multispectral imaging and color reproduction.It is also the basis for the classification and matching of hyperspectral images on ground plants.The significance of plant spectral measurement and analysis is very crucial.The visible and near-infrared reflectance spectra of ground plants are measured and analyzed in order to provide data for remote sensing classification and recognition,spectral imaging and color reproduction of ground plants.The article mainly completed the following work:(1)Measurement of reflectance spectrum of trees and flowers in the visible and nearinfrared bands using a hyperspectral imaging spectrometer in the room.The measured plants include: 42 species of trees such as Eucalyptus,Laurel,Ginkgo,and Maple;8 kinds of flowers such as Grass,Azalea,Tulip,and Rose.The experiment obtained for a total of 50 trees and flowers.Radiation correction and noise removal are performed on the spectral data.(2)The reflectance spectra characteristics of the plants were analyzed.Firstly,the basic spectra characteristics of trees and flowers are analyzed.Secondly,the reflectance curve of the plant is analyzed in different types and seasons.Finally,the reflectance spectrum feature analysis was performed by first derivative and red edge parameters.These analyses laid the foundation for spectral imaging and classification and identification of ground plants.(3)In visible and near-infrared bands,reflectance spectrum data of flowers and trees are processed by PCA(Principal Component Analysis)and correlation analysis.In the visible light band,the cumulative contribution rates of three principal components are 0.978 and 0.970,the cumulative contribution rates of five principal components of trees and flowers is 0.995.In the near-infrared band,flowers and trees have three principal components.The cumulative contribution rates of three principal components are 0.998 and 0.996.The results of correlation analysis showed that the correlation between the reflectance spectrum of visible band and near-infrared band are 0.238 and 0.316,which is low correlation.
